James Ross, CEO of Lightning International
Thoughts about this year’s Filmart:
“It’s a useful market even though there’s an emphasis on film, but I’m pleasantly surprised that TV content is in demand as well. There are quite a few major TV content distributors based in Hong Kong but I am surprised that they’re not here. For us, it’s been tremendously useful; and it helps we’re based here.”
Buyer sentiment:
“Buyers are looking for unique programmes, something different. Some might not know exactly what they’re looking for (till they see it), but they’re definitely in the market for something different.”
“We are meeting quite a lot of buyers from Southeast Asia; Vietnam and Cambodia in particular. Some of the genres they expressed interest in include Chinese and Korean drama, among others.”
